Information on pressure vessels
Pressure vessels store substances under pressure higher than atmospheric conditions, and are found all over the world. They are used at home for hot water storage, in many different factories and plants, and in mining and oil refineries.

Welding and Fabrication Engineering
As we know well, welding is an ancient art which is prevailing since the Bronze Age. It is the process used to join materials, usually metals or thermoplastics by melting the work pieces.
